This study presents the experimental advancements in the generation and dosimetric characterization of laser-plasma accelerated Very High Energy Electron beams (100–250 MeV) for radiobiological applications.
These beams, known for their deep tissue penetration and reduced sensitivity to anatomical inhomogeneities, have been studied to evaluate their potential in advanced radiotherapy applications.
The experimental work involved dosimetric measurements using stacks of EBT3 radiochromic films to map the dose distribution of a collimated electron beam with a 7 mm diameter. Dose delivery was evaluated for multiple ultra-high dose rate pulses. The characterization was performed to optimize irradiation and dose measurement for radiobiological samples.
3D-printed sample holders designed and produced for these experiments are described. These holders are adaptable to various containers (e.g., 0.5 ml Eppendorf tubes, 2 ml cryotubes, and 25 mm Petri dishes) and can integrate radiochromic dosimeters and stainless steel collimators to enhance irradiation precision. A motorized centering device enables precise sample positioning within the irradiation field. Additionally, a new holder with orthogonal angular movements and laser-guided alignment significantly improve beam alignment and irradiation homogeneity.
